Running STM32H7 at 1.8V with USB High speed ULPI PHY USB3310

caleb
Associate III

Hello all,

I'm building a system that I'd like to run at 1.8V with an STM32H7 and USB high speed PHY.

I have a few questions, so I'll just jump right in:

1) Will the STM32H7 core run at 400MHz when powered by VDD=1.8V? Some MCUs can't run as fast at lower voltages, so I wanted to make sure it'll run fine at 1.8V.

2) Internal (full-speed) phy: As long as I supply VDD33USB I assume it will work fine. However, is 3.3V required on VDD33USB if I'm using an external ULPI phy at 1.8V? The datasheet is not clear. It says in table 22 of STM32H570 datasheet: VDD33USB: USB USED 3.0-3.6V, USB not used: 0-3.6V. I suspect VDD33USB only powers the on-board full-speed PHY, but I'm not sure.

3) Has anybody tried the USB3310 PHY with STM32H devices at 1.8V? It would be great to know if I can expect this to work 🙂
